§ 348.075 — Rules and regulations, promulgation, procedure.

Text

The authority shall have the power, as necessary or convenient to carry out and effectuate the purposes and provisions of sections 348.005 to 348.180 .  Any rule or portion of a rule promulgated under the authority of sections 348.005 to 348.180 shall become effective only if it has been promulgated in compliance with the provisions of chapter 536 as it may be amended from time to time.
